Dr. Michael Galvan, PhD is a frequent contributor to our CES events. He has an extensive background in directing retreats and facilitating Scripture Study.  He received his Ph.D. from the Graduate Theological Union (Berkeley) in Christian Spirituality.  Currently, Dr. Galvan is  CRIL's Executive Director [Community Resources for Independent Living]. Prior to that, he was Program Director for 9 years. Michael brings a love and expertise to Scripture studies and an understanding of living the Word of God.

Part 1: "Scriptural Foundations and Prophetic Voices"

Delve into the profound messages of hope and redemption woven throughout the Scriptures, from the Old Testament to the New Testament. Explore how the prophets spoke of a future filled with promise and renewal. This episode will highlight their timeless words, revealing how prophetic hope has shaped and sustained faith through the ages.

Part 2: "The Call of Jubilee 2025: Embracing Renewal and Restoration"

Investigate the significance of the Jubilee Year 2025, a time of reflection, restoration, and renewal. This episode will examine how the biblical concept of Jubilee—rooted in the ideas of forgiveness, freedom, and community—resonates in contemporary times. We'll explore how modern movements and religious communities are heeding this call, working towards social justice, economic equality, and environmental stewardship, in line with prophetic visions of a just and hopeful future.
